**Mgmt Meeting Minutes — Retiring the Brightline Range**

Quick recap for sales leads at Fenholt Supplies: we agreed to retire the Brightline fixture range by year-end. Remaining stock moves to clearance pricing next month, and accounts on standing orders get migrated to the Lumetta range. Trade-in incentives were approved in principle. The confidential note on next steps sits just below.

board note of bajof-bajeg: The pricing group signed off on a budget of $13.4 million for Project Sildor. The renewal with Lamixek Holdings closes at $48.9 million a year, 49 percent above the last contract.

Subject: DR drill results — thumbnail generation queue

Team,

During Thursday's disaster-recovery drill for the Pixelforge thumbnail queue, we confirmed that failover to the Brackenhollow standby cluster completes in under four minutes, provided the consumer offsets are restored first. Future maintainers: always drain the queue before switching regions, and verify the resizer workers re-register. To unlock the sealed offset snapshot during a real recovery, you will need the passphrase below.

unlock words, hahip-baduf: holwyn-istath-julvan

[ ] Verify the Lattermill GraphQL N+1 fix before Thursday's cut. The batching loader now covers the roster and invoice resolvers; staging shows query counts down from ~400 to 6 on the dashboard view. Confirm no cache staleness on nested mutations. Approved artifacts carry the token shown directly below.

trace token, kahog-tajeg: htk6_97d963